如何在平台上接入以太坊钱包:详细指南

                                在当今数字货币和区块链技术迅猛发展的背景下,以太坊钱包的接入成为许多在线平台和去中心化应用(DApp)开发者的重要任务。以太坊不仅是一种加密货币(ETH),同时也是一个支持智能合约的区块链平台,拥有强大的去中心化应用生态系统。因此,了解如何在平台上接入以太坊钱包不仅能够为用户提供更方便的交易方式,还能提升平台的用户体验和技术竞争力。

                                一、以太坊钱包的基础知识

                                以太坊钱包是用于管理用户以太币(ETH)及代币的一种工具。与传统银行账户类似,用户通过以太坊钱包可以接收、发送加密货币,承担智能合约的交互等功能。以太坊钱包的种类繁多,包括热钱包(在线钱包)和冷钱包(离线存储)两大类。

                                热钱包方便用户快速访问其资金并进行交易,适合频繁交易的用户。通常通过网页或手机应用提供服务。而冷钱包则注重安全性,适合长时间持有资产的用户,如硬件钱包和纸质钱包。

                                二、接入以太坊钱包的步骤

                                接入以太坊钱包时,您需要考虑多个方面,包括选择适合的钱包类型、与以太坊网络的接口调用、前端界面的用户交互等。下面是接入以太坊钱包的基本步骤:

                                1. 选择以太坊钱包提供商

                                首先,您需要选择合适的以太坊钱包提供商,如MetaMask、Trust Wallet、MyEtherWallet等。这些钱包各有特点,MetaMask是浏览器扩展,用户易于访问,Trust Wallet则是一款移动端应用。选择适合您平台目标用户群体的钱包提供商至关重要。

                                2. 集成API或SDK

                                大多数以太坊钱包提供API或SDK,供开发者调用,从而实现与钱包的集成。例如,使用MetaMask时,可以通过其JavaScript API进行智能合约的调用和交易的发起。确保阅读官方文档,了解其快速集成的方法。

                                3. 用户身份验证

                                在用户开始使用钱包之前,需进行身份验证。大部分以太坊钱包通过连接到用户的账户实现身份验证。您需引导用户通过钱包应用授权访问,确保用户的操作安全。

                                4. 交互界面设计

                                用户体验是连接钱包成功的关键,确保界面简单易懂,用户可快速进行充值、提现及代币交易。设计时需考虑多种终端和设备,保证跨平台访问的流畅性。

                                5. 安全性和合规性

                                在集成以太坊钱包时,要注重安全性,遵循当地的法律法规,确保用户资金的安全。使用HTTPS加密传输数据,并定期审核您平台的安全性和合规性。

                                三、常见问题解答

                                Q1:以太坊钱包如何保护用户资产安全?

                                以太坊钱包通过多种方法保护用户资产,通常包括公私钥加密、助记词、两步验证等机制。公私钥加密是加密货币交易的核心,用户的私钥绝对不能泄露,因为拥有私钥即拥有管理该地址内所有资产的权利。

                                助记词是生成私钥的一种辅助方式,通常由12/24个随机单词组成,用户可以通过记住这些单词来恢复钱包。此外,一些钱包插件提供两步验证功能,增加额外的安全层,防止未授权的交易。

                                再者,冷钱包(如硬件钱包)和热钱包(如应用钱包)的结合也能有效保护资产。频繁交易使用热钱包,长期持有则转移至冷钱包以确保安全。

                                Q2:平台接入以太坊钱包会面临哪些技术挑战?

                                接入以太坊钱包可能面临多种技术挑战。首先是网络延迟问题,用户在发起交易时,若节点网络拥堵,可能导致交易被延误。而交易确认时间的长短也会影响用户体验,尤其是在以太坊网络高负荷情况下。

                                其次是兼容性问题,由于不同以太坊钱包和网络标准更新较快,开发者需要时刻关注其兼容性,确保钱包更新时不会影响到您的平台功能。

                                还有,安全性也是一大挑战,尤其是涉及到用户的私钥和助记词时,任何泄露都可能导致重大损失。此外,平台需要实施强有力的加密措施,并定期审计安全策略,以减少潜在的安全隐患。

                                Q3:用户如何选择合适的以太坊钱包?

                                在选择以太坊钱包时,用户应考虑多个因素,包括安全性、易用性、支持的功能和API可访问性等。首先,用户应了解钱包的安全性,查询其是否存在过往的安全漏洞事故,钱包是否提供助记词或私钥的保护机制。

                                其次是易用性,用户可以选择界面友好、操作简便的应用程序。如MetaMask提供简单的浏览器扩展,使用户不需要进行复杂配置即可快速使用。

                                此外,用户还应关注钱包对多种代币的支持能力,以及与去中心化兑换(DEX)的兼容性,确保能够灵活交易。

                                Q4:未来以太坊钱包的发展趋势是什么?

                                以太坊钱包的未来发展趋势主要集中在以下几个方面:

                                首先是跨链整合,随着多种区块链技术的兴起,以太坊钱包将可能支持对多个区块链的资产管理,提供更为广泛的资产交易和管理功能,满足用户的需求。

                                其次是智能合约的自动化,更多的以太坊钱包将可能集成更多的DeFi(去中心化金融)功能,使用户能够自动化进行贷款、质押、交易等操作,简化用户的操作流程,大幅提升资产的流动性。

                                最后是增强安全性,随着黑客行为的增多和用户对安全的重视,未来以太坊钱包将更多地采取多重签名、分布式存储等策略,以保护用户的资产不被损失。

                                总体而言,平台接入以太坊钱包是一个复杂但具有重要价值的过程,准确把握这一领域的动态和技术创新,将有助于提升平台的市场竞争力。

                                            author

                                            Appnox App

                                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                            related post

                                                                            leave a reply